Robert Theodore Bourdow, age 94 passed away on November 11, 2020 at the Friendly Village in Rhinelander. He was born on June 18, 1926 to William and Katherine (Giffore) Bourdow in Saginaw, Michigan. Bob served in World War II in the Navy and was stationed in the Philippines in 1945. He was always very proud of his service. After, serving in the military he went on to Michigan Tech and received a degree in forestry. He later married and relocated in the Wausau area where he and his wife raised four children. While in Wausau, Bob worked in Real-estate, owned commercial photography studio, and was a consultant for the Wausau papers. After, his children were grown, Bob moved to Rhinelander where he worked at Marplex until he retired. After, his retirement, he worked part-time at Home Depot. Bob loved the outdoors. He enjoyed hunting, fishing, pistol shooting, and going to Hodag Park to watch the boats and people. Bob spent many hours taping old movies, especially old westerns. John Wayne was his favorite. He enjoyed going to McDonalds once a week with a group of friends. Thank you Tom DeValk, for being Bob’s longtime friend, he really enjoyed your company. Bob is survived by his sons, William Bourdow, Richard (Victoria) Bourdow, daughters, Jennifer Bourdow, Amy Gau, grandchildren, Jacob and Jessica Bourdow and Dana Gau. Bob is also survived by his beloved partner and friend of over 30 years, Judy Rice, her children Stephen (Michelle) Rice, Stevie, Mattea, and Murphy Rice, and Jenny (Michael) Chaperon. He will be sadly missed by all who knew him. Bob is preceded in death by his parents William and Katherine Bourdow, brothers, Miles and Lee, sister Anne, and nieces, Linda and Susan.
